Transaction 07dd64a91082a816cc17e55c63a0c48e330c065c49bae5a73cd50d71bbd9f47f
1 Input
1 Output
-
07dd64a91082a816cc17e55c63a0c48e330c065c49bae5a73cd50d71bbd9f47f:0
- value
- 638591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9571d6651805b7efc382df0b6107a3e741a7626d OP_EQUAL
- address
- 3FKCyhAQ6LMksTaMspU4UZ5Qdzwn1i8AMf